Internet Radicalization : Actual Threat or Phantom Menace?

Approved for public release; distribution is unlimited === Popular opinion expresses fear that accessing radical Islamic content and connecting with extremist networks through Internet functionalities causes radicalization and recruitment to commit terrorist acts.
